avatar for Colleen Mullin

Colleen Mullin

SD79
Vice-Principal
I am a lifelong high school Chemistry/Science teacher who was gifted the role of administration of alternative education and distributed learning programs in recent years. I started my career in Kashechewan Ontario, then worked 12 years in Fort Saint James BC and then 6 years in Merritt BC. Most recently I have joined a team in Duncan BC at CVOL (CVOLC and The Grove). Living the dream!
I am an advocate for personalized education within alternative learning environments. I believe all students can learn and will learn once we identify their gifts/ sparks, and stretches and then create a program specific to those needs. Kids will flourish if they can.
